Police in the North are investigating a suspected hate crime after an incident at the sportsground used by East Belfast GAA.

The PSNI received a report that oil had been poured around goalposts at Henry Jones Playing Fields in Castlereagh.

Investigators said they are treating the criminal damage as a hate crime.

The pouring of the oil is believed to have occurred on Tuesday night.
